Talent.com
Senior Software Test Engineer
Senior Software Test EngineerANA, Inc • Henderson, NV, United States
Senior Software Test Engineer

Senior Software Test Engineer

ANA, Inc • Henderson, NV, United States
1 day ago
Job type
  • Full-time
Job description

About ANA :

Join a recognized industry leader - Alliance North America was proudly named a 2025 Top Workplace in the Manufacturing Industry, an honor based entirely on feedback from our own employees about our culture, values, and workplace experience.

Alliance North America was established in 2017 and is proud to be the sole North American supplier of AIRMAN Power Generators, AIRMAN Air Compressors, MAC3 Pneumatic Air tools, and ANA's exclusive Energy Boss ™ - Hybrid Energy System and Smart load bank system. Our commitment to our customers is to Make their World Easier, by answering the phone, understanding their needs, and taking ownership to provide them with solutions. With a large parts inventory and more than 90% of all orders shipping within 24 hours, you never have to worry about spare parts. We help keep your fleet in top condition with our world class Support Department, who are always ready to help and be a resource by providing training on our equipment.

ANA is headquartered in Henderson, Nevada, with locations in Cypress, California, and Spartanburg, South Carolina. ANA is growing and scaling, and we are seeking a Senior Software Test Engineer to join our growing team in an onsite position in Henderson, Nevada.

As a Senior Software Test Engineer, you will have the opportunity to lead our testing efforts and ensure the delivery of high-quality software products. The ideal candidate will have a strong background in software testing methodologies, excellent problem-solving skills, and the ability to manage testing activities for complex software projects. As a Senior Software Test Engineer, you will work closely with development teams, product managers, and other stakeholders to define and execute test strategies that ensure the robustness and reliability of our software solutions.

The position is fully onsite, and the work schedule is weekdays at 8 : 00 - 5 : 00pm. This role reports to the Director of Software Development.

Key Responsibilities :

  • Test Strategy and Planning : Develop comprehensive test strategies and plans for software projects, including functional, performance, security, and regression testing. Collaborate with project stakeholders to understand requirements and define test objectives, scope, and schedules. Identify and mitigate risks associated with software testing and ensure alignment with project timelines.
  • Test Design and Execution : Design, develop, and execute test cases based on software requirements and design specifications. Lead the creation of automated test scripts and frameworks to improve testing efficiency and coverage. Conduct exploratory testing to identify edge cases and potential issues that automated tests may not cover. Perform manual testing as needed, particularly for complex or high-risk areas of the software.
  • CI / CD Environment : Design, develop, and maintain a CI / CD environment for a small to medium size software team. This includes setting up and maintaining build scripts, build pipelines, and branch policies to ensure best practices are followed and a quality product is delivered.
  • Defect Management : Identify, document, and track defects using appropriate tools and processes. Work closely with development teams to ensure the timely resolution of issues. Provide clear and actionable feedback to developers, including steps to reproduce issues and suggestions for improvements.
  • Continuous Improvement : Mentor and guide junior test engineers, providing technical leadership and support. Drive continuous improvement initiatives within the testing process, including adopting new tools, techniques, and best practices. Analyze test results and metrics to identify areas for improvement and optimize testing processes.
  • Collaboration and Communication : Collaborate with cross-functional teams, including developers, stakeholders, and product managers, to ensure a seamless integration of testing activities within the software development lifecycle. Participate in project planning, provide updates on test progress, challenges, and outcomes. Communicate effectively with stakeholders to ensure timeliness and quality of deliverables. Provide effective feedback throughout the development process. Foster a culture of collaboration by driving clear communication and teamwork within the team.
  • Other duties as assigned.

Qualifications :

  • Education : Bachelor's degree in Computer Science, Software Engineering, or a related field. Master's degree preferred
  • Experience : 5-10 years of experience in software testing, with a focus on project-level test management and leadership
  • Demonstrated proficiency leading small teams in an agile, fast paced, environment
  • Highly proficient developing test software using Python / Pytest
  • Proficient developing software requirements and test plans
  • Proficient with agile and CI / CD environments such as github and github actions
  • Proficient with build tools, CI / CD tools such as Cmake, Make, Cross-Compilers and docker
  • Proficient with SCM tools such as git
  • Proficient with Linux programming and integration using C / C++ / Python
  • Proficient with AWS and cloud software
  • Familiarity with graphical development environments including QT
  • Familiarity with network protocols such as Modbus, MQTT and TCP-IP
  • Familiar with hardware / software integration such as J1939, CANOpen and RS485
  • Experience with Hybrid power systems
  • Experience with Energy Management System, Power System and Micro-grid control algorithms
  • Familiarity with industry standards such as IEEE 2030, 61850, 62898, 1547-2018 and ISO 15118
  • Proven experience in testing complex software systems, including web, mobile, and embedded applications.
  • Experience with test automation tools and frameworks (e.g., Selenium, TestNG)
  • Familiarity with continuous integration / continuous deployment (CI / CD) pipelines and related tools (GitHub, GitLab)
  • Experience with performance testing tools (e.g., JMeter, LoadRunner) and security testing practices
  • Excellent analytical and problem-solving skills with a keen attention to detail
  • Strong leadership and mentoring abilities
  • Effective communication and collaboration skills
  • Ability to manage multiple projects and priorities in a fast-paced environment
  • Experience in Agile or Scrum environments
  • Certification in software testing (e.g., ISTQB, CSTE)
  • Familiarity with cloud-based testing and DevOps practices
  • ANA Core Values :

  • Root Cause Problem Solving
  • Be Creative with Solutions
  • Build open and honest relationships
  • Build a positive team and family spirit
  • Be inclusive
  • Look for better ways
  • Be humble
  • Urgency
  • Benefits & Perks :

  • Competitive pay
  • 401k with company contribution
  • Medical, Dental, & Vision
  • Life Insurance
  • Voluntary Accident Insurance
  • Voluntary Critical Illness Insurance
  • Employee Assistance Program
  • Employee Appreciation Programs
  • $130,000 - $150,000 a year

    The salary range for this role is $130,000 - 150,000 per year, which serves as a guide for pay decisions. Final compensation will be determined by a of factors, such as candidate's qualifications, experience, and skills, as well as pay equity considerations.

    You must be based in the United States and authorized to work in the U.S. without employer sponsorship. Please be advised that ANA does not provide employment-based visa sponsorship for this position at this time.

    ANA is proud to be an Equal Opportunity employer. We do not discriminate based upon race, religion, color, national origin, sex (including pregnancy, childbirth, or related medical conditions), sexual orientation, gender, gender identity, gender expression, transgender status, sexual stereotypes, age, status as a protected veteran, status as an individual with a disability, or other applicable legally protected characteristics.

    Create a job alert for this search

    Software Test Engineer • Henderson, NV, United States

    Related jobs
    Test Products from Home – $25-$45 / hr + Freebies

    Test Products from Home – $25-$45 / hr + Freebies

    OCPA • Winchester, Nevada, us
    Part-time +1
    Product Testers are wanted to work from home nationwide in the US to fulfill upcoming contracts with national and international companies. We guarantee 15-25 hours per week with an hourly pay of bet...Show more
    Last updated: 30+ days ago • Promoted
    Remote Software Quality Engineer

    Remote Software Quality Engineer

    VirtualVocations • Henderson, Nevada, United States
    Remote
    Full-time
    A company is looking for a Remote Software Quality Engineer on a contract basis.Key Responsibilities Implement test automation for systems and assist scrum teams in testing and validating code T...Show more
    Last updated: 4 days ago
    Middle QA Engineer

    Middle QA Engineer

    VirtualVocations • Henderson, Nevada, United States
    Full-time
    A company is looking for a Strong Middle QA Engineer for a healthcare project on a part-time basis.Key Responsibilities Review requirements to ensure clarity and testability Design and execute m...Show more
    Last updated: 30+ days ago
    Systems Engineer - Operation Test and Evaluation

    Systems Engineer - Operation Test and Evaluation

    Spectrum Comm • Las Vegas, NV, United States
    Full-time
    We are seeking a skilled Systems Engineer to support an Operational Test and Evaluation (OT&E) contract for the U.The ideal candidate will have experience in Air Force operational test environments...Show more
    Last updated: 1 day ago • Promoted
    Senior QA Engineer

    Senior QA Engineer

    VirtualVocations • Henderson, Nevada, United States
    Full-time
    A company is looking for a Senior QA Engineer - Site Lead.Key Responsibilities Lead and manage the QA team to ensure quality standards are met Develop and implement testing strategies and proces...Show more
    Last updated: 30+ days ago
    QA Analyst

    QA Analyst

    VirtualVocations • Henderson, Nevada, United States
    Full-time
    A company is looking for a QA Analyst to join their IT Services department on a primarily remote basis.Key Responsibilities Ensure quality and integrity across all custom-developed software Crea...Show more
    Last updated: 30+ days ago
    QA Analyst, Android

    QA Analyst, Android

    VirtualVocations • Henderson, Nevada, United States
    Full-time
    A company is looking for a QA Analyst focused on Android.Key Responsibilities Execute manual test cases for new features, bug fixes, and regression testing on Android applications Perform functi...Show more
    Last updated: 1 day ago
    Automation Tester

    Automation Tester

    VirtualVocations • Henderson, Nevada, United States
    Full-time
    A company is looking for an Automation Tester with expertise in the Momentum Suite platform.Key Responsibilities Review requirements and documentation to understand verification processes Design...Show more
    Last updated: 30+ days ago
    Software Test Engineer

    Software Test Engineer

    VirtualVocations • Henderson, Nevada, United States
    Full-time
    A company is looking for a Software Test Engineer for a remote position supporting the Department of Veterans Affairs.Key Responsibilities : Develop detailed test plans, test cases, and test scrip...Show more
    Last updated: 30+ days ago
    Manual Testing Lead

    Manual Testing Lead

    VirtualVocations • Henderson, Nevada, United States
    Full-time
    A company is looking for a Test Lead - Manual.Key Responsibilities Engage with stakeholders to understand requirements and prepare test scenarios and cases Execute test cases and manage defects ...Show more
    Last updated: 22 days ago
    QA Engineer

    QA Engineer

    VirtualVocations • Henderson, Nevada, United States
    Full-time
    A company is looking for a QA Engineer, responsible for performing manual and automated testing for internal CRM systems and ensuring high product quality. Key Responsibilities Perform comprehensi...Show more
    Last updated: 30+ days ago
    Systems Quality Assurance Lead

    Systems Quality Assurance Lead

    VirtualVocations • Henderson, Nevada, United States
    Full-time
    A company is looking for a Systems / IT Quality Assurance Lead.Key Responsibilities Applies ISO 20000 and CMMI-SVC / DEV for automation, software integration, and systems engineering Aligns with Agi...Show more
    Last updated: 4 days ago
    Logistics QA Coordinator - HICP

    Logistics QA Coordinator - HICP

    Nevada Staffing • Henderson, NV, US
    Full-time
    Logistics Quality And Food Safety Coordinator.Under the direction of the Logistics Quality Supervisor, coordinates quality and food safety programs and verifies documentation outlined in the Qualit...Show more
    Last updated: 6 days ago • Promoted
    QA Test Automation Engineer

    QA Test Automation Engineer

    VirtualVocations • Henderson, Nevada, United States
    Full-time
    A company is looking for a QA Test Automation Engineer.Key Responsibilities Design, develop, and maintain automated API test suites for geospatial APIs and microservices Collaborate with cross-f...Show more
    Last updated: 4 days ago
    Software QA Engineer

    Software QA Engineer

    VirtualVocations • Henderson, Nevada, United States
    Full-time
    A company is looking for a Software QA Engineer II to ensure the quality of Salesforce implementations and data cloud projects. Key Responsibilities Design and execute comprehensive test plans for...Show more
    Last updated: 30+ days ago
    Manual QA Engineer

    Manual QA Engineer

    VirtualVocations • Henderson, Nevada, United States
    Full-time
    A company is looking for a Manual QA Engineer to support quality assurance activities for projects involving Adobe Experience Manager and Adobe Workfront Fusion integrations.Key Responsibilities ...Show more
    Last updated: 30+ days ago